| Every wedding and party needs some form of entertainment, so why not a DJ? I am a mobile disk jockey who provides sound, music and lighting for any event. I'll make your wedding or party a memorable one, while having fun at what I enjoy doing - music!
I have over , songs to spin, and that library is growing daily. Along with playing music, I can make general announcements, entertain, provide sound and lighting for other people, and work with other vendors at an event to make sure everything runs smoothly.
Clients are offered a free consultation meeting (in person if close to Eugene, OR; over phone or through e-mail if not) to discuss my services, music that should be played and any other details that will need to be gone over before the event. After that we can stay in contact through e-mail and phone to make any changes or add last minute requests to your playlist.
If you don't live in Eugene and are still interested in my services, don't worry - I'll travel! My free consulatation meeting can take place over the phone or through e-mails, and I'll work just as hard to make sure that your event rocks!
Weddings:
My standard wedding package includes:
- Announcement of bridesmaids and best men
- Announcement of bride and groom
- Bride and Groom dance
- Father/Daughter dance
- Mother/Son dance
- Money Dance (optional)
- Announce Cake Cutting
- Toasts
- Provide projector and audio for any dvd/video/slideshow made for wedding
- Backround music
- Dance/Party music
Equipment:
My current equipment includes:
Sound: Mackie FR Professional Amplifier, PA-FX Crate amp/mixer, Nady MC- " speakers, Kustom " Speakers, Behringer B X Pro Eurolive Professional Series Subwoofer, Behringer -way stereo/ -way mono crossover, wireless mics
Music: Ion iCD KSP Dual-CD mixer/player, CD's, HP Pavilion dv nr Entertainment Notebook PC, GB Video iPod
Lights: Dell MP Projector, American DJ Vertigo, American DJ Colorpod, American DJ Mini Starball, American DJ Agressor, American DJ Mystic, American DJ minifog, Chauvet Lil' Bubbler
Misc: Speaker stands, light stand, microphone stand, speaker/microphone cables, extension chords, power strips

| The Club Jazz Band is this generation's answer to the call for the continuation of traditional jazz music. These four college-age musicians come from different locations along the west coast and with their diverse musical influences they have developed a unique style while maintaining the essence of traditional jazz.
Bob Draga, Titan Hot Clarinetist ( / / ): "It is nice to see musicians that started out as youth players in the youth jazz programs now working professionally! Club Jazz Band understands the importance of a great jazz program and also understands the concept of being both musical and entertaining! I wouldn't hesitate to recommend Club Jazz Band for any jazz festival!"
Club is intent on making an impact on the world of traditional jazz while at the same time inspiring others to join in the effort to keep the music alive. At this point this group is very interested in performing anywhere, everywhere, and as often as they can. Their travels have lead them all throughout Oregon and have recently extended southward to the Sacramento Jazz Jubilee. Having sold numerous copies of their first CD, A Closer Walk ( ), their next CD will be released early . This is one band that no one will want to miss as they climb the musical ladder.
